The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of John Pickton, born in 1825 in Warrington, Lancashire, consisted of 7 members. John was the head of the household, married to Winifred Pickton, born in 1829 in Hindley, Lancashire, England. They had 5 children; James (born 1859 in Hindley, Lancashire, England), Alice (born 1862 in Hindley, Lancashire, England), Jane (born 1864 in Hindley, Lancashire, England), Joseph (born 1866 in Hindley, Lancashire, England) and Charles (born 1872 in Hindley, Lancashire, England).
